Heavenly Sweet Condensed Milk Bread Recipe

Description

Condensed milk bread delights bakers with its rich, pillowy texture and sweet undertones. Homemade loaves provide a comforting treat you’ll savor with morning coffee or afternoon tea.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 3.5 cups (440 g) all-purpose flour
  • 1 packet (2.25 tsps) instant yeast
  • ¼ cup (50 g) granulated sugar
  • ½ tsp salt
  • ¼ cup (60 g) un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 large egg (for egg wash)
  • ¼ cup (60 ml) sweetened condensed milk
  • ½ cup (120 ml) warm milk
  • ¼ cup (60 ml) warm water
  • 1 tbsp water (for egg wash)

Instructions

  1. Ingredient Fusion: Combine flour, instant yeast, sugar, and salt in a large mixing bowl, ensuring uniform distribution of dry components.
  2. Liquid Integration: Whisk warm milk, condensed milk, melted butter, egg, and water into a smooth, cohesive liquid mixture.
  3. Dough Development: Merge wet and dry ingredients, kneading thoroughly by hand or using a stand mixer with dough hook for 5-6 minutes until achieving a silky, elastic consistency.
  4. Primary Fermentation: Form dough into a compact ball, place in a greased bowl, and cover with a damp cloth. Allow rising in a warm, draft-free location for 1-1.5 hours until volume doubles.
  5. Shaping Preparation: Deflate dough and divide into 8-10 equal portions, rolling each into smooth balls and arranging closely in a greased 9-inch baking pan.
  6. Secondary Proofing: Drape pan with a damp cloth, allowing dough to rise for 30-40 minutes until noticeably puffy and expanded.
  7. Baking Transformation: Preheat oven to 350F. Brush dough surface with egg wash to create a glossy, golden exterior. Bake for 20-25 minutes until bread develops a rich golden color and produces a hollow sound when tapped.
  8. Finishing Touch: Rest bread in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ack for cooling. Serve warm or at room temperature, enjoying the soft, pillowy texture of freshly baked condensed milk bread.

Notes

  • Precise Temperature Control: Ensure water and milk are warm (around 110°F) to activate yeast without killing it, critical for perfect bread rise.
  • Kneading Technique Matters: Develop gluten through consistent, rhythmic kneading until dough becomes smooth and elastic, preventing dense texture.
  • Proofing Environment: Place dough in warm, draft-free area like inside turned-off oven with light on, maintaining steady 80-85°F for optimal fermentation.
  • Egg Wash Perfection: Brush thin, even egg wash layer using pastry brush for glossy, golden-brown crust that looks professionally baked.
